Hunting @ mentioned first in kjv@Genesis:10:9 in connection with Nimrod. Esau was "a cunning hunter" kjv@Genesis:25:27). Hunting was practised by the Hebrews after their settlement in the "Land of Promise" kjv@Leviticus:17:15; kjv@Proverbs:12:27). The lion and other ravenous beasts were found in Palestine ( kjv@1Samuel:17:34; kjv@2Samuel:23:20; kjvKings:13:24; kjv@Ezekiel:19:3-8), and it must have been necessary to hunt and destroy them. Various snares and gins were used in hunting kjv@Psalms:91:3; kjv@Amos:3:5; kjv@2Samuel:23:20). War is referred to under the idea of hunting kjv@Jeremiah:16:16; kjv@Ezekiel:32:30).
